Knight Frank has successfully let half of the newly refurbished office space located just yards from Sheffield's Heart of the City project to three multi-media companies within just 12 weeks of the building's release to market.
The Sheffield office of Knight Frank and joint agent Lane Walker have leased more than 6,500 sq ft of prime city centre office space in the Turner Investments' development of MidCity House which faces The Moor shopping area and is highly recognisable with its curved pillar-supported façade.
Web, print and software design agency 3Squared and website hosting solutions business KDA Web Services are set to move into 1,000 sq ft suites on the second floor. They join marketing and advertising specialist Rapture Promotions which has taken 4,500 sq ft on the first floor.
Phase two of the refurbishment, which has seen a new glass reception added to the building, is now completed.

MidCity House forms a gateway to Pinstone Street and is within walking distance of the prestigious Heart of the City project, Orchard Square shopping centre, the refurbished Leopold Square and the city's legal quarter.
Tenants of the offices also benefit from close proximity to large-scale development of Arundel Gate, which includes two new multi-storey car parks, a new Jury's Inn, and proposed redevelopment of The Moor shopping facilities.
MidCity House also benefits from excellent public transport links, modern décor and lighting, open plan layouts, fully carpeted accommodation, new suspended ceilings and Disability Discrimination Act compliance throughout.
